The American bald eagle is a bird of prey found in North America. It is the national bird and symbol of the United States of America. The bald eagle has a white head, neck, and tail, and a dark brown body. It has a wingspan of 6 to 7 feet and weighs between 8 and 14 pounds. Bald eagles are known for their powerful talons, which they use to catch fish, their primary food source. They also eat small mammals and birds. Bald eagles are found near bodies of water, such as lakes, rivers, and coastal areas, where they can find fish.
